the analysis of

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"the analysis of" is correct and usable in written English.
You typically use it when you are discussing the examination of something (such as a text, data, or other material) in order to better understand it. For example: "The analysis of the data showed that the policy was ineffective."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

When using "the analysis of", ensure that the object of analysis is clearly stated to avoid ambiguity. For instance, instead of saying "the analysis was conducted", specify "the analysis of the market data was conducted".

Common error

Avoid phrasing that obscures who performed the analysis. Instead of saying "the analysis was performed", specify who did the analysis to provide clarity and accountability, like "the research team performed the analysis".

FAQs

How can I use "the analysis of" in a sentence?

You can use "the analysis of" to introduce the subject being examined. For example, "The analysis of the data revealed a significant trend".

What are some alternatives to "the analysis of"?

Alternatives include "analyzing", "examining", or "assessment of", depending on the specific context.

Is there a difference between "the analysis of" and "the study of"?

"The analysis of" often implies a more detailed deconstruction and examination, while "the study of" can refer to a broader investigation or exploration of a topic.

When is it appropriate to use "the analysis of" in formal writing?

It's suitable for formal writing when you need to emphasize the detailed examination and interpretation of data, results, or information. For example, you might use it in scientific papers, reports, or academic essays.
